✔✔Fluid Requirements: 1-10kg - ✔✔100ml/kg
✔✔Fluid Requirements: 11-20kg - ✔✔1000ml+50ml/kg x each kg >10 kg
✔✔Fluid Requirements: >20kg - ✔✔1500ml+20/kg X each kg >20kg
✔✔Celiac Disease - ✔✔- intolerance to gluten
- inborn error of metabolism or an immunologic response
- strict avoidance of gluten
✔✔Celiac Disease: S/S - ✔✔- Diarrhea (watery and pale w/ offensive odor
- Anorexia
- Abdominal Pain & Distension
- Muscle wasting particularly in the buttocks and extremities
✔✔Celiac Disease: Interventions - ✔✔- gluten free diet substituting corn, rice and millet
as grain sources
- mineral and vitamin supplementation including iron, folic acid and fat soluble vitamins
A, D, E and K
✔✔Celiac Disease: Foods to Avoid - ✔✔- barley, rye, wheat
- beer
- bread
- cakes/cookies
- pasta
- imitation meat or fish
- processed lunch meat
- vegetables in sauce
- soups
- snack foods
- salad dressings
, ✔✔Celiac Disease: Foods that are Ok - ✔✔- eggs
- fish
- poultry
- beans
- nuts
- seeds
- fruits and veggies
- some dairy
✔✔Rotavirus: S/S - ✔✔- mild to moderate fever
- vomiting followed by onset of watery stools
- fever and vomiting generally abates in 2 days but diarrhea persists for 5-7 days
✔✔Appendicitis: S/S - ✔✔- RLQ pain
- fever
- rigid abdomen
- decreased or absent bowel sounds
- vomiting
- constipation or diarrhea
- anorexia
- tachycardia
- pallor
- lethargy
✔✔Ruptured Appendix - ✔✔same as appendicitis - peritonitis develops as appendix
has ruptured
✔✔Gastro-Esophageal Reflux - ✔✔- Dysfunction of the lower sphincter = transfer of
gastric contents into the esophagus
- delay of gastric emptying
- susceptibility of esophageal injury
- usually improves in 12-18 months
✔✔Gastro-Esophageal Reflux: Therapeutic Management (Positioning) - ✔✔- put them
up in a car seat after feedings
- prop them up
✔✔Gastro-Esophageal Reflux: Feedings - ✔✔- smaller more frequent feedings
- burp several times during feedings
- thickened feeds/formulas (1 tsp or 1 tbsp of rice per ounce of formula
- enlarge nipple hole for thickened foods
